Water damage can strike at any second, leaving homeowners in misery. Understanding DIY water damage restoration techniques can empower individuals to tackle the state of affairs effectively, probably saving time and money.


The first step in dealing with water damage entails assessing the extent of the problem. Homeowners must determine the source of the water intrusion, whether or not it be from a leaky roof, burst pipes, or flooding. Taking instant action can minimize the damage. Ensure security by turning off electrical energy and gas where essential, and at all times put on protecting gear similar to gloves and masks.

Once the source of the water has been identified and controlled, it's essential to deal with the dampness in your house. Begin by eradicating any standing water utilizing buckets, mops, or a wet/dry vacuum. This will not only help clear the world but additionally cut back the possibilities of mold and mildew formation.

After the majority of the water has been removed, the next step is drying out the affected areas. Open home windows and doors to advertise air flow, and utilize followers or dehumidifiers to accelerate the drying process. It is important to dry the area rapidly to prevent additional damage to structures and belongings.


Inspect materials for damage. Drywall, flooring, and furnishings can all be affected by water. If drywall has absorbed too much water, it could need to be reduce out and changed. Similarly, flooring may require removing if it has warped or turn into detached. Salvaging items can get financial savings, but owners must be pragmatic about what can be restored.

In areas prone to mold, think about using a diluted mixture of bleach and water for cleansing surfaces. This will assist in killing mold spores and stopping progress. It’s vital to work in a well-ventilated surroundings and to wear correct protective gear when coping with mold.

How do I effectively dry out my house after water damage?undefinedUse a mix of followers, dehumidifiers, and pure ventilation to increase airflow. It’s essential to dry the area within 24 to 48 hours to stop mold progress. Consider eradicating soaked carpets or drywall for thorough drying.

What materials do I need for DIY water damage restoration?undefinedBasic supplies include mops, buckets, sponges, towels, a wet/dry vacuum, fans, and dehumidifiers. Additionally, you might require protecting gear such as gloves and masks, depending on the severity of the damage.


How can I prevent mold development after water damage?undefinedKeep the area dry and well-ventilated. Use fans and dehumidifiers to hold up low humidity ranges. If mold is visible, clean it with a combination of water and detergent or a specialised mold remover, following safety guidelines.




Is it protected to use electrical appliances after water damage?undefinedNo, it is important to avoid using electrical appliances until the area is completely dry and the electricity has been turned off. Water and electrical energy can create hazardous situations, rising risks of shock or hearth.


When should I think about hiring professionals for water damage restoration?undefinedIf the water damage is in depth, has affected electrical systems, or if mold growth is present, it’s finest to consult professionals. Their experience ensures security and thorough restoration, which may be more effective than DIY methods.

How can I inform if my possessions are salvageable after water damage?undefinedAssess the material—items made of porous materials like material and paper could additionally be ruined, whereas sealed objects, steel, and glass can usually be cleaned. Refer to guidelines on specific items or seek the guidance of professionals for better evaluation.

What insurance coverage do I want for water damage restoration?undefinedReview your homeowner’s insurance coverage coverage to know what kinds of water damage are covered, such as sudden leaks versus long-term issues. Contact your insurer for clarification and contemplate further coverage if necessary.


How do I deal with disagreeable odors after water damage?undefinedClean the affected areas completely to remove any residue or moisture causing odors. Baking soda may help take up lingering smells, and an air purifier may help in enhancing air quality. If odors persist, professional cleansing may be required.
